Penn State York: Visit to Think Loud Development Center/United Fiber & Data
The Graham Center for Entrepreneurial Leadership Studies at Penn State York regularly offers presentations by entrepreneurs and leaders in our community to our students. For GEW, The Graham Center students will visit Think Loud Development, a venue that is part of the revitalization of downtown York.

Focused on urban revitalization, Think Loud's projects serve to enhance culture, civic pride and the environment. Their highly publicized projects in York, Reading and Allentown represent an extraordinary effort to revitalize key urban areas in underserved parts of the Commonwealth. With more than 450,000 square feet of ongoing construction and a growing portfolio of Pennsylvania real estate, the company is dramatically impacting the local communities of York, Allentown, and Reading, with sights set on Lancaster as well. Think Loud’s current investments total over $50 million. Seeing bricks and mortar as only a shell to house the potential within, Think Loud combines inspired development, creative strategy, and a deep sense of social responsibility that ultimately contributes to viable downtown economies and revitalized communities. The Think Loud Development company was started by members of the music band LIVE, so the underlying rocker theme makes this event even cooler.
